Address

MG6XAcdWZonfxZHNzuVU6FnynFXofff5Hc

0 MONA

Confirmed
Total Received73.28227448 MONA
Total Sent73.28227448 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MG6XAcdWZonfxZHNzuVU6FnynFXofff5Hc73.28227448 MONA
 
 
MG6XAcdWZonfxZHNzuVU6FnynFXofff5Hc73.28227448 MONA